THE CONSTRICTOR HITCH might either be the MOST DANGEROUS ...OR...The MOST USEFUL knot out there. Use this one with caution, and DONT ever tie it around body parts - because it's nearly impossible to get undone. That being said, it has a number of amazing uses which I explain thoroughly. A Great knot for Camping, Prepping, Bushcraft and Survival.

When tying this knot with a non-stiff rope, like paracord, especially without the inside lengths, it will bind up so tight that you'll nearly always have to cut it loose. This knot is a close-cousin of the CLOVE hitch, and has the advantage of two extra working ends that when used, wont affect the movement of the actual knot itself.
